Transaction d777543da49b27aa1875d3235201eec628683a52633c3ca6f67914cc013c3325
1 Input
1 Output
-
d777543da49b27aa1875d3235201eec628683a52633c3ca6f67914cc013c3325:0
- value
- 151030
- script pubkey
- OP_0 OP_PUSHBYTES_20 50e51e8b00c885e2ad44eb738d6a081789f72200
- address
- bc1q2rj3azcqezz79t2yadec66sgz7ylwgsq9ehmuz